Position Summary

The Import & Export Compliance Analyst is responsible for the Import and Export regulatory compliance. This position supports STERIS' import and export activities through monitoring and maintaining the STERIS Compliance Program. In this role, you will ensure that STERIS international shipments are handled in an efficient manner while meeting all international Customs and U.S. government export and import laws. In addition, you will assist other team members with understanding regulations and clearing shipments with all government agencies.

Duties
  • Maintain and update the STERIS Harmonized Classification Database as required.
  • Properly classify STERIS products with the correct harmonized code for Customs entry and export.
  • Distribute the Harmonized Classification Database to STERIS Customs brokers.
  • Prepare and submit binding tariff ruling requests for various products as required to support accurate import tariff classification, valuation, origin, and marking of STERIS US and Canada imports.
  • Respond to Customs inquiries.
  • Answer questions & provide information to STERIS Customs brokers as it relates to Compliance and other government agency inquiries.
  • Ensure STERIS importations are compliant with the U.S. and Canadian import regulations in all areas - including but not limited to: valuation, country of origin, trade preference programs, reported quantities and packaging markings.
  • Assist STERIS locations with determining country of origin of manufactured goods based upon Country of Origin regulations.
  • Procure all required information for participation in all Trade Preference programs as required and ensure STERIS products properly qualify, should STERIS participate in one or more program. Provide and maintain any and all certification surrounding the participation in such program(s), including but not limited to:
    • USMCA (US-Canada-Mexico)
    • KORUS (US-Korea)
    • AUSTFA (US-Australia)
    • Israel
    • Singapore
    • Columbia
    • Peru
    • Panama
    • DR-CAFTA (Costa Rica, El Salvador, Guatemala, Honduras, Nicaragua, Dominican Republic)
Duties - cont'd
  • Declare GSP (Generalized System of Preferences) for goods being imported and having country of origin from GPS relevant designated countries.
  • Ensure China exclusions are being applied to import declarations as applicable.
  • Work with appropriate departments to obtain FDA, EPA, and TSCA information for US importation.
  • Obtain and process APHIS and USDA permits relating to importation of goods applicable.
  • Handle TIB (Temporary Importation under Bond) and T&E (Transportation & Export) bonds as needed.
  • Request Post Summary Corrections (US) and B2 (CA) corrections as required.
  • File Commodity Classification Automated Tracking System (CCATS) to obtain the proper Export Control Classification Number (ECCN)
  • Have working knowledge of STERIS compliance system, Integration Point.
    • Perform compliance checks as required.
    • Evaluate compliance failures for correctness and override failure if not valid after investigation.
    • Address issues and assist users with operating the system.
  • Prepare Customs invoices when required to support the movement of STERIS cargo.
  • Calculate and submit to brokers reconciliation valuation timely.
  • Ensure STERIS participation and maintenance in various Customs security programs as deemed necessary.
  • Provide insurance certificates and steel/aluminum license applications as required.
  • Assist the Import & Export Compliance Supervisor in the evaluation of Customs brokers and international transportation providers.
  • Provide assistance to all STERIS Internal/External Customers as it relates to resolving issues relating to Customs or export regulation issues to or from a STERIS or STERIS supplier/vendor facility
  • Provide assistance with other department duties as required.

Required Experience
  • Bachelor's Degree.
  • 4 years experience in Customs related activity.
  • Experience with classifying goods with US export and import HTS codes.
  • Must have demonstrated proficiency using personal computer applications, with at least 3 years experience using email (Outlook), word processing (Word), spreadsheets (Excel), and Windows applications. Must be able to effectively work with Excel spreadsheets using formulas and functions.
  • Demonstrated excellent written and oral communication skills with the ability to effectively and tactfully interact with customers and others at all levels of the organization and in outside agencies.
  • Demonstrated effective decision making, problem solving and organizational skills.
  • Ability to multi-task in a fast paced, results driven environment.
Preferred Experience
  • Customs broker license and/or knowledge in international transportation processes, preferred.
